Formed in 1984 in Orange County, California, The Offspring (led by vocalist/guitarist Dexter Holland and bassist Greg K.) emerged as a flagship act of the 1990s punk rock revival. Alongside bands like Green Day and Rancid, they brought punk’s energy into the mainstream. Their signature blend of sardonic lyrics, driving guitar riffs, and melodic hooks produced multi-platinum albums such as Smash (1994), Americana (1998), and Conspiracy of One (2000).
